VBA2 [VBA] find A Data와 B Data 비교하여 A Data의 값이 B Data에 없을때 추가 하려고 하니.. 어떻게 해야 할지.. 고민을 겁나게 하다가... 찾아서 없으면 넣으면 되잔아!!!! 라는 결론에 들었고.. (당연하잔아!! ㅡㅡ;) 아래와 같이 테스트를 해보았다.. Sub test() Dim AData As Range, BData As Range, rAData As Range, rBData As Range Dim AData _count As Integer, BData _count As Integer ' 기존 데이터에서 리스트를 뽑자 Set AData= Sheets("ASheet").Range("A1").CurrentRegion AData _count = AData.Rows.Count Set rAData =.. 2023. 8. 21. [VBA] Error 사용자 함수 (Error control in VBA) [VBA] Error 사용자 함수 엑셀의 경우 VBA와 엑셀 사이의 수 많은 변수 및 사용자들의 수정으로 인해 에러가 없을 수가 없다 하지만 일반 사용자에게 디버그문을 띄울 수 없기에 에러가 발생 가능한 상황에서 적절한 On Error문을 활용해야 한다 예를 들어 "A"라는 파일을 열어서 작업을 하도록 지시해 놓았지만 그 사이 "A"가 삭제 되었을 수가 있는데 이럴 땐 파일이 없다던지 하는 메세지를 띄워야지 디버그를 하라고 띄우면 안된다는 것이다 On Error 에러 처리 방법 1. On Error GoTo 레이블 On Error 상황일 때는 해당 레이블로 이동하는 방법 레이블 뒤에는 : 문을 붙여서 레이블임을 나타내 줍니다 Sub 프로시저() On Error GoTo Test // 에러 상황이면 tes.. 2020. 2. 29. 이전 1 다음